When people search "top 10 digital marketing websites" or similar queries, they're looking for curated lists of the best platforms, tools, and resources in the industry. These aren't official rankings—they're organic search results and content pieces that aggregate what people consider the most valuable digital marketing destinations. Think of them as modern word-of-mouth recommendations that Google and other search engines rank based on authority, engagement, and relevance. For agencies, understanding what lands on these lists matters because being featured on them drives qualified leads, establishes credibility, and positions your agency as a thought leader in your niche.

The practical value for your agency is significant. When prospects search these discovery queries, they're often early in their decision journey—they know they need help with digital marketing but haven't committed to a specific solution yet. If your agency appears on a "top digital marketing agencies" or "best SEO companies" list, you're getting visibility at a crucial moment. Being featured on reputable listicles acts as a third-party endorsement, which converts better than your own website claims ever could. It also drives highly qualified traffic because people are actively comparing options rather than just browsing. Additionally, landing on these lists strengthens your overall SEO and domain authority, which has downstream benefits for your own organic rankings across other keywords your clients actually search for.

To leverage this practically, start by identifying the specific listicle queries your target clients actually search. Rather than generic terms like "top 10 digital marketing websites," research what your ideal clients specifically look for—perhaps "best digital marketing agencies for startups" or "top SEO agencies in [your region]." Create a list of the publications, directories, and reviewer platforms where these lists appear, then systematically work toward getting featured. This might involve submitting to platforms like Clutch, G2, or industry-specific directories; earning reviews on Google and Trustpilot that push you higher in local discovery lists; or creating exceptional work and case studies that earn mentions in industry publications. Many agencies overlook the simple step of directly reaching out to journalists and content creators who publish these roundups, providing them with information about your agency that makes it easy to include you.

Beyond the immediate lead generation benefit, these listicle rankings influence how potential clients perceive your competitive position. If your competitors appear on five "best agencies" lists and you appear on none, that absence creates doubt even if your work is equally strong. Make this part of your agency's broader visibility strategy by tracking which lists your competitors appear on, then systematically pursuing those same opportunities while also identifying emerging platforms where early placement could give you a first-mover advantage.
